Track 1 - good mood setter. liked it. very trancey. i would've probably left it on shorter and taken it out with a cut between the 5 and sixth min would've been cool.
Really liked track 2 and I'm buying it and using it soon awesome tribal feel and nice vocal. kinda weird but cool beat.
the change from two to three was good idea but the phrases weren't matched appropiately.
Really liked this next track, very good bass cut and thump. good track choice to follow leeds track.
Enjoyed very much this next track and cut. very good with the high cuts.
Voodoo People - The time - very good tribal electro track.
Very Nice change into this next track, excellent.
Again, excellent change into this simon and shaker track, very good flow these past couple of tribal tracks.
Awesome tech house track, very good cut again.
Worked this next build up very nicely
Very good deep house track, enjoyed this one very much. Great vocal and break.
Very good follow up with the tech house
Nice quick change, liked it. Very nice and mellow track.
not my fav track in the world but i guess it works here. (sweat)
Good cut here, nice tribal beat. Excellent Synth.
Good transition here at the end. Very nice.
I enjoyed the set very much, couple nice tracks i hadn't heard before. Has a lot of unity in style but sometimes too tribal for my personal taste, would've liked to hear more electro or tech rather than so much tribal, but again thats just a matter of personal style, and it definately has some to it with the trancey feels and hypnotic tribal beats. Nice job dude, keep it up.

8/10
Nice warmup set. I believe if you were to open as the main event for a club setting it wouldn't work out because this set builds too slow hence my initial statement. Everything is pretty much spot on, but what I liked most about your mixing style is your progression. You do a very good job making sure each track complements each other well. To sum up I enjoyed this set for its flow and the effort you put behind this set. Thanks for the share and try picking things up a little faster next time!
